@Alvaro, I did a few tests in relation to fleet support of ground units. Below are a few points and a request or two.

1. My tests indicate that fleet support make a difference to ground combat when they are in the same *non* port hex.

2. My testing cannot confirm that fleets *in* a port help the ground units in the port. Can you check this please Alvaro?

3. Could you add information in the Combat report of fleet support for attacker and defender, just like you do for air units.

The answer is yes they can support units from ports. I almost took it out. But if a player wants to keep their fleet that close to the front without air support they run the risk of the fleet being sunk.
